| Preferred Name | Characteristic |
| Definitions |
A characteristic represents a property of an entity that can be measured (e.g., height, length, or color). A characteristic of an entity is observed through a measurement, which further asserts a value of the characteristic for the entity. A characteristic type (e.g., "height") can be associated with many different entities, whereas an individual characteristic (a particular occurrence of the "height" characteristic) is associated to exactly one entity.
